AULA F75 Pro Wireless Mechanical Gaming Keyboard — Full Review

The AULA F75 Pro is a 75% tri‑mode wireless mechanical keyboard designed for gamers and custom‑keyboard fans who want premium features without the premium price. With hot‑swappable sockets, pre‑lubed Reaper switches, PBT keycaps, RGB lighting, and a smooth metal volume knob, the F75 Pro delivers a custom‑board feel at a budget‑friendly cost.

It supports Bluetooth, 2.4GHz wireless, and USB‑C wired mode, making it a flexible option for gaming PCs, laptops, tablets, and mobile devices.

Specifications

FeatureDetails
Layout75% (81 keys)
ConnectivityBluetooth 5.0, 2.4GHz wireless, USB‑C wired
SwitchesPre‑lubed AULA Reaper switches
Hot‑SwappableYes (3‑pin & 5‑pin compatible)
KeycapsSide‑printed PBT
BacklightingRGB
BatteryLong‑life rechargeable
ExtrasMetal volume knob, foam dampening layers
CompatibilityWindows, Mac, Linux

Performance & Real‑World Use

The F75 Pro performs extremely well for its price. The Reaper switches are smooth out of the box thanks to factory lubing, and the gasket‑style dampening gives the keyboard a soft, muted sound profile — much closer to custom keyboards than typical gaming boards.

In 2.4GHz mode, latency is low enough for gaming, and Bluetooth mode works great for productivity or mobile devices. The RGB lighting is bright and customizable, and the volume knob is a standout feature that feels premium.

Typing feels stable, with minimal wobble thanks to decent stabilizers. They’re not high‑end, but they’re better than most keyboards in this price range.

Alternatives to Consider

  • Royal Kludge RK84 — Similar layout, cheaper, but lower build quality.
  • Keychron K2 Pro — Better software + QMK/VIA support, higher price.
  • Epomaker TH80 Pro — Great sound profile, similar price range.
